SII vs. ZVRA
SII (Sprott Inc) and ZVRA (Zevra Therapeutics Inc.) are both stocks. SII operates in Asset Management (Financial Services), while ZVRA operates in Biotechnology (Healthcare). Over the past 5 years, SII returned 25.04%/yr vs -2.85%/yr for ZVRA. At a 0.18 correlation, their price movements are largely independent.

Drawdowns
SII vs. ZVRA -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um SII drawdown since its inception was -47.81%, smaller than the maximum ZVRA drawdown of -99.27%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for SII and ZVRA.
